Ticket: Vault "drayton-deps" locked after failed rotation. Context for reviewers: our dependency pinning policy requires exact versions in the Bindweed manifest; the auto-updater tried to bump a pinned hash and tripped the vault's tamper lock. Fix: revert the updater commit, keep pins exact, add a policy check to CI. Unlocking the vault to restore the manifest signing key requires the recovery passphrase below.

strongbox words: sorir-belvan-rusix-ulays-ralmir-praix-eliir-tamax-praael-druael-julir-tamius-jorir

Hey Tomas — handing this over before I head off. The score sheets from the Westvale regional chess final are in the blue folder on the shelf behind the dispatch counter. The federation wants the originals, not scans, so they go out on tomorrow's morning run to Aldercourt. Don't fold them, the arbiter was very clear. Courier hand-over instruction is noted just below.

dispatch memo: the lamwyn fenwyn courier leaves the wenir ledger at gate 7175 under passcode 822969

## v2.14.0 — Payment Retry Idempotency

Added idempotency keys to the Lumera checkout retry path. Each retry now reuses the original key, preventing duplicate charges when the gateway times out mid-transaction. Keys are persisted for 48 hours and scoped per merchant account. Reviewers should note the new unique constraint on the retry ledger table and the backfill migration, which runs in batches of 500. The change below was authored and verified by the following engineer.

signatory, hahap-fawef: Belys Ulador Zorok Belix

CI note for future maintainers of the Crashfern pipeline: if the symbolication stage for the Pebbletap mobile app hangs, it's usually a stale dSYM cache on the runner, not the uploader. Clear the cache volume and re-run only the symbolicate job; a full rebuild wastes an hour. Before filing anything, attach the trace token from the failed stage, shown below.

session token of tajef-bageg = htk21_5d90d574934f3ccae6437